Handover — Veltrow partnership. The Veltrow term sheet is at second draft; exclusivity clause still contested. Legal review due Thursday. Marta pushed back on the 24-month lock-in; expect Veltrow to counter at 18. Do not confirm volume commitments until pricing annex is signed. Files are in the deal room. Read the note below before your first call.

board note of fahag-tajop: The eastern region missed its Julix quota by 44.0 percent last quarter. Ralionax Holdings plans to lower the Druath list price by 61.8 percent in March. The board signed off on a budget of $295.0 million for Project Gilath. The renewal with Ruswynix Systems closes at $274.5 million a year, 17.0 percent above the last contract.

### Step 4: Enable the pricing experiment

The Gatefold ticket-pricing experiment replaces the flat-rate module. Complete steps 1–3 first (schema migration, flag registry sync, cache flush). Do not enable the experiment on tenants still running the legacy checkout — it will double-apply discounts. Assignment is deterministic by account hash, so no sticky-session work is needed. Once the flag registry is synced, restart the pricing workers so they pick up the new bucketing. Then apply the experiment configuration shown here.

deployment values, yadug-bawif:
[framir]
team = pelox
access_code = ac_a38ab2
owner = tamion.julael
host = framir.tolvaqlabs.test
port = 11211
peer = tammir.zemvargrid.local
salt = 2215ef03
pin = 1541

Action item AI-4 (Quillden outage, severity 2): Refactor the legacy ORM layer in the Bramblecore billing service. The incident showed that the hand-rolled mapper silently swallows constraint violations, which delayed detection by four hours. New team members: do not add features to the old mapper; all new models go through the replacement adapter. Owner is the billing platform squad, target is end of next quarter. Migration guide and module ownership map are on the page below.

dashboard of kajep-tajog = https://harbor.tolvaqworks.example/pipeline/run/dash/pipeline/228e278bbf9b3bc2

Ticket: Staging env misconfigured for Siftgate bloom filter

The bloom layer in front of the Pellet KV store is rejecting all lookups in staging because the env file was copied from the dev template without credentials. False-positive tuning values are fine; only the auth line is missing. To unblock the weekly demo, the Pellet admission secret must be set on the following line.

env line for yaguf-fajop: LEDGER_TOKEN13=fb08984397349